build: Fix finding the headers for GStreamer
authorcommit-queue@webkit.org <commit-queue@webkit.org@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Mon, 1 Aug 2011 11:53:51 +0000 (11:53 +0000)
committercommit-queue@webkit.org <commit-queue@webkit.org@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Mon, 1 Aug 2011 11:53:51 +0000 (11:53 +0000)
commitff5725b19c5281df696fc0ea891584e81e58b7c3
treeb769db0ff92cb6d1ba1794de2cbb2b0ff6a2fad3
parent3f7d010484af5cd037d616f8af24fe0c50959f5c
build: Fix finding the headers for GStreamer

The cmake files to find the various GStreamer packages were all
checking for the header gst/gst.h. However if gst-plugins-base is
installed into a separate prefix from gstreamer then all of these
tests would only pick up the gstreamer include path so the build
would fail. This patch changes it to try and find a file
appropriate to each package.

https://bugs.webkit.org/show_bug.cgi?id=64933

Patch by Neil Roberts <neil@linux.intel.com> on 2011-08-01
Reviewed by Martin Robinson.

* Source/cmake/FindGStreamer-App.cmake:
* Source/cmake/FindGStreamer-Base.cmake:
* Source/cmake/FindGStreamer-Interfaces.cmake:
* Source/cmake/FindGStreamer-Pbutils.cmake:
* Source/cmake/FindGStreamer-Plugins-Base.cmake:
* Source/cmake/FindGStreamer-Video.cmake:

git-svn-id: https://svn.webkit.org/repository/webkit/trunk@92123 268f45cc-cd09-0410-ab3c-d52691b4dbfc
ChangeLog
Source/cmake/FindGStreamer-App.cmake
Source/cmake/FindGStreamer-Base.cmake
Source/cmake/FindGStreamer-Interfaces.cmake
Source/cmake/FindGStreamer-Pbutils.cmake
Source/cmake/FindGStreamer-Plugins-Base.cmake
Source/cmake/FindGStreamer-Video.cmake